David Michael Aronoff

Summary

David Michael Aronoff is a human[1]. He worked as a physician[2], university teacher[3], and medical researcher[4].

Body

Education

Educated at Tufts University[13], a university[24], in United States[25], founded in 1852[26] and Indiana University[14], a state university system[27], in United States[28], founded in 1820[29], headquartered in Bloomington[30].

Career and Affiliations

Recorded occupations include physician[2], university teacher[3], and medical researcher[4]. Fields of work include bacterial infectious disease[5], an infectious disease[31]; innate immune response[6], a biological process[32]; human gut flora[7]; Clostridium difficile[8], a taxon[33]; Clostridium[9], a taxon[34]; and Streptococcus[10], a taxon[35]. Employers include Vanderbilt University[11], a private university[36], in United States[37], founded in 1873[38], headquartered in Nashville[39] and Indiana University School of Medicine[12], a medical school[40], in United States[41], founded in 1903[42], headquartered in Indianapolis[43].
